SEO (Search Engine Optimization) is a key component of digital marketing that focuses on improving a website’s visibility in search engine results, such as Google, Bing, and Yahoo. The goal of SEO is to increase organic (non-paid) traffic by ranking higher for relevant search queries.
Key Elements of SEO:
✅ On-Page SEO – Optimizing website content, meta tags, headings, and images for better search rankings.
✅ Off-Page SEO – Building backlinks, social signals, and improving domain authority.
✅ Technical SEO – Enhancing website speed, mobile-friendliness, and fixing crawl issues.
✅ Keyword Research – Finding high-ranking and relevant keywords to target the right audience.
✅ Content Optimization – Creating valuable and SEO-friendly content to attract users.
✅ Local SEO – Optimizing for local searches to attract nearby customers.
Why is SEO Important?
✔️ Boosts website traffic & brand visibility
✔️ Builds credibility & trust with users
✔️ Generates leads and sales organically
✔️ Cost-effective compared to paid ads
SEO is a long-term strategy that helps businesses grow their online presence, attract more customers, and stay ahead of competitors.
SEO Keyword Research: A Guide to Finding the Right Keywords
Keyword research is the process of finding and analyzing the search terms people use on search engines like Google. It helps businesses optimize their content to rank higher, attract the right audience, and drive organic traffic.
Steps for Effective Keyword Research:
✅ 1. Identify Your Niche & Goals – Understand your industry, target audience, and business objectives.
✅ 2. Brainstorm Seed Keywords – Think of broad terms related to your business (e.g., “digital marketing services”).
✅ 3. Use Keyword Research Tools – Utilize tools like:
- Google Keyword Planner
- Ahrefs
- SEMrush
- Ubersuggest
- Moz Keyword Explorer
✅ 4. Analyze Search Volume & Competition – Find keywords with high search volume but low competition.
✅ 5. Focus on Long-Tail Keywords – Target specific, less competitive phrases (e.g., “best digital marketing services for small businesses”).
✅ 6. Check Competitor Keywords – Analyze what keywords competitors are ranking for and identify gaps.
✅ 7. Prioritize User Intent – Choose keywords that match informational, navigational, or transactional intent.
✅ 8. Optimize Content – Incorporate selected keywords naturally in titles, headings, meta descriptions, and content.
Types of Keywords in SEO:
🔹 Short-Tail Keywords – Broad and highly competitive (e.g., “SEO”)
🔹 Long-Tail Keywords – More specific and conversion-friendly (e.g., “best SEO strategies for e-commerce”)
🔹 LSI (Latent Semantic Indexing) Keywords – Related terms that improve SEO relevance
🔹 Geo-Targeted Keywords – Keywords with a location (e.g., “SEO services in New York”)
